U+1E2E0 "ðž‹ " Wancho Letter Tsa is a symbol from the Wancho script, an abugida used for writing the Wancho language spoken primarily in parts of India and Myanmar. This specific letter represents the consonant sound "tsa" and is part of a modern unified script that was added to the Unicode Standard in 2019 with Version 12.0, supporting the preservation and digital representation of the Wancho language. Its design reflects traditional Wancho calligraphic forms, playing a role in cultural and linguistic documentation for the community.
